TP stands for Taxpayer, so Taxpayer IRA Deduction.  This would be the amount of IRA contribution deduction that is going into the Taxpayer's IRA.  The 'taxpayer' is the first person listed on a joint tax return.

 

If there is also a spouse shown on your return you may see SP in the place of Spouse.
